US Military Blockade of Iranian Ports Begins in Strait of Hormuz

The U.S. military has initiated a blockade of Iranian ports in the Strait of Hormuz, with President Trump issuing a warning.

The United States military has commenced a blockade of Iranian ports situated within the Strait of Hormuz. This action represents a significant development in the ongoing tensions surrounding the vital shipping lane.

Reports indicate the blockade is now active, focusing on restricting access to Iranian ports. President Donald Trump has issued a stern warning, stating that any Iranian warships that approach the U.S. blockade will be "killed."

The operation aims to secure the Strait of Hormuz. This is a developing story and will be updated as details emerge.
